Dreaming of sound nights filled with deep sleep? Achieving blissful slumber can often feel like a distant goal, but it's closer than you think! By implementing practical changes to your daily routine and bedroom, you can unlock the secrets to battling insomnia and waking up feeling refreshed.

Here are a few tips to get you started on your journey to better sleep:

  • Establish a consistent bedtime routine that signals to your body it's time to wind down.
  • Build a calming bedtime ritual, such as taking a warm bath, reading a book, or listening to relaxing music.
  • Minimize screen time in the hours before bed, as the blue light emitted from electronic devices can interfere with your sleep cycle.

By following these strategies, you can pave the way for sound sleep and enjoy all the advantages that come with it.

Enhance Your Sleep: Proven Techniques for Deeper Rest

Unlock the secrets to restful slumber with these time-tested techniques. A consistent sleep schedule helps your body's natural pattern, leading to more restorative sleep. Create a calming bedtime routine that signals to your mind and body it's time to unwind. Avoid caffeine and alcohol before bed, as they can hinder your sleep. A cool, dark, and quiet bedroom setting is ideal for sound sleep. If you find yourself struggling to fall asleep, try progressive muscle relaxation. These practices can ease your mind and body, promoting a state of deep slumber.

Optimizing Your Rest for Optimal Health

Sleep is not merely a period of inactivity; it's a vital biological process crucial for both physical and mental well-being. During sleep, our systems work tirelessly to repair tissues, consolidate knowledge, and boost our immune function. Understanding the science of sleep can empower us to make informed choices that promote restful slumbers and ultimately improve our overall health.

To enhance website your sleep, consider these evidence-based strategies:

* Create a regular sleep pattern, going to bed and waking up around the same time each day, even on weekends.

* Craft a relaxing bedtime ritual to signal your mind that it's time to unwind.

* Make a sleep-conducive environment that is dark, quiet, and cool.

By embracing quality sleep, we can unlock its profound benefits and flourish in all aspects of our lives.
